From f6f6120e706df84ab64df6881a570631636a5a47 Mon Sep 17 00:00:00 2001 From: Peter Clement Date: Tue, 3 Sep 2024 21:14:05 +0100 Subject: [PATCH] Update packages/server/src/api/routes/utils/validators.ts Co-authored-by: Sam Rose --- packages/server/src/api/routes/utils/validators.ts |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/packages/server/src/api/routes/utils/validators.ts b/packages/server/src/api/routes/utils/validators.ts index e68d5b3795..9218223d08 100644 --- a/packages/server/src/api/routes/utils/validators.ts +++ b/packages/server/src/api/routes/utils/validators.ts @@ -91,7 +91,8 @@ export function datasourceValidator() { ) } -function filterObject(unknown = true) { +function filterObject(opts?: { unknown: boolean }) { + const { unknown = true } = opts || {} const conditionalFilteringObject = () => Joi.object({ conditions: Joi.array().items(Joi.link("#schema")).required(),